为比较卷毛大鼠与SD大鼠皮肤毛囊形态学区别,探讨卷发机理,采用病理组织学和电镜技术观察突变大鼠皮肤毛囊结构。组织学结果显示卷毛大鼠皮肤毛囊弯曲,毛囊皮质内根鞘鞘小皮层排列不规则。扫描电镜下卷毛大鼠毛干弯曲,毛干横断面为扁平形,根鞘厚薄不均。透射电镜观察发现突变大鼠毛囊内根鞘细胞内见多量透明蛋白颗粒与角蛋白丝形成的均质状复合物,排列不规则。研究结果表明,突变基因可能引起毛囊内根鞘细胞角化过程不一致和中间丝的不规则排列而导致卷发。
The morphology of hair follicle from Yuyi curly rats was studied and compared with SD Littermates to explore the mechanisms of the bending of the hair shaft. Through observing the structure of hair follicle by histology and ultrastructure. Histological analysis showed that all hair follicles were bent,and unregular layer of the inner root sheath (IRS) in the mutant rats,but not in SD rats. Scanning electron microscopic showed that the mutant hair shaft was curved and une- ven thickness of cross sections. Compound of trichohyalin granula and intermediate filaments(IF) were observed in the IRS of the mutant. The results showed that inconsistent keratinization and irregulary IF in the cell of the IRS were associated with curliness of hair follicles in mutant stains.
